An Offaly electrician who seriously assaulted a man after being hit from behind in a Dublin pub toilet has been given a four-year sentence.

Shane Egan (29), who has no previous convictions, paid €20,000 to the victim as a token of remorse for the assault which the court heard was “out of character”.

Egan, Curraghvarna, Banagher, pleaded guilty at Dublin Circuit Criminal Court to assault causing harm at Flannery’s Pub, Lower Camden Street, in the south city centre on October 31st, 2004.

Judge Patricia Ryan imposed a four-year sentence with the final two years suspended.
